    Mom's Super Awesome Jello Salad
    1 Box (6 oz) Lime Jello
    1 Can (20 oz) crushed pineapple
    1 Cup Nuts (optional, and you can definitely use as many or as little as you want)
    1 regular sized tub Cool Whip
    2 Cups Buttermilk (I know.. sounds gross, but it def tastes good in the end!)

    Use the juice from your crushed pineapple to dissolve jello over heat. Once dissolved, add pineapple and remove from heat. Stir in buttermilk. Pour into dish to solidify gelatin mixture. Once solidified, fold in Cool Whip and make sure it's thoroughly mixed. Add nuts (if you want). Put your salad back in the fridge to re-solidify for about an hour or two. Enjoy!

    Dirty Martini

    Put a martini glass into the freezer

    Put a dozen ice cubes in a shaker

    Pour 3 ozs of the juice out of a bottle of green olives over the ice

    Shake (the shaker)

    Pour back into the olive jar and save the juice

    Add 3 jiggers of COLD vodka to the shaker (Surely you are keeping your vodka in the freezer!!)

    Shake (see above)

    Strain into your martini glass

    Add 3 olives ..

    .. and 2 ice cubes from your shaker

    Enjoy!!

    Oh yeah, the vermouth. Just glance at the bottle. That will be enough for your drink.

    Swedish Meatballs from Sandy Woods (a close friend of my husband's family):

    meatballs:
    1/2 lb ground beef
    3/4 C. uncooked oats
    1/2 tsp salt
    1/2 tsp garlic salt
    1/2 tsp pepper
    2 Tbsp milk
    1/2 C finely chopped onion

    Combine all ingredients thoroughly. Shape into 1 inch balls and pan fry in small amount of oil until brown.

    Sauce:
    1 Tbsp ginger
    2 Tbsp Brown sugar
    8 oz tomato sauce
    1 Tbsp Worchestershire sauce
    pepper to taste

    Sandy doubles this sauce and BOY is it good...

    Mix all ingredients for sauce and pour over meatballs! Voila!

    101st Airborne Beer Cheese Soup
    1 large can chicken broth
    1 medium jar cheese whiz
    1 can stale beer
    cayenne pepper to taste
    Heat broth to boiling, reduce heat, add cheese whiz, stir till melted, add
    beer and reheat, but do not boil. Top with bacon bits and green onions

    A&W Chili Dogs
    1 Sabrett brand 2 ounce beef frankfurter (7½" long)
    1 regular hot dog roll
    3 Tablespoons A&W Coney Island Sauce (see recipe below)
    1 Tablespoon chopped white onion
    1/2 Tablespoon Kraft shredded mild cheddar cheese (optional)
    A&W Coney Island Chili Dog Sauce
    1 pound ground chuck
    1 six ounce can Hunts tomato paste
    1 Cup water
    1 Tablespoon sugar
    1 Tablespoon prepared yellow mustard
    1 Tablespoon dried, minced onion
    2 teaspoons chili powder
    1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
    1 teaspoon salt
    1/2 teaspoon celery seed
    1/2 teaspoon ground cumin (heaping)
    1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
    Making the Chili Dog Sauce:
    1. In a 2 qt. saucepan, brown the ground chuck, breaking into very small
    pieces. Salt and pepper lightly while cooking. Do not drain the fat.
    2. Add the remaining ingredients. Simmer, uncovered, 30−45 minutes until it
    thickens. Stir occasionally.
    3. Allow to cool, cover, and refrigerate until "Dog−Time". You'll be
    microwaving what you need later.
    Cooking your A&W Chili Dog
    1. Bring a 2 qt. saucepan of water to a rolling boil.
    2. Remove the saucepan from the heat, and add the desired number of
    frankfurters to the water. Cover and let sit about 10 minutes.
    3. After the franks are done, microwave the chili dog sauce until steaming.
    (Only microwave what you need, save the rest) Then microwave each hot dog
    roll 10 seconds....just enough to warm.

    LYNCHBURG LEMONADE

    Ingredients

    (1) 5th of Jack Daniels Bourbon, (Old #7)
    (1) 5th of Triple Sec fruit liquor, I usually get orange flavor
    (2) 2 liter bottles of Country Time Lemonade
    (4) good sized lemons
    (1) Large bag of ice

    In a large pitcher, I have a (1) gallon pitcher...fill it 1/2 way with ice and pour the Jack in about 1/2 way up the ice and the then pour the Triple-Sec in just enough to barely cover the ice. Slice up (2) lemons and squeeze in the juice and fill the rest of the pitcher with the Country Time lemonade...stir really well. The Jack Daniels won't even be tasted but DAM ITS GOOD!! Excellent cookout drink!!!!!

    VELVEETA Southwestern Chicken Skillet

    1 lb. boneless sk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
    2 cups elbow macaroni, uncooked
    1/2 lb. (8 oz.) VELVEETA Pasteurized Prepared Cheese Product, cut up
    1 can (10 oz.) RO*TEL Diced Tomatoes & Green Chilies, undrained
    1/2 cup BREAKSTONE'S or KNUDSEN Sour Cream
    2 Tbsp. chopped fresh parsley (optional)

    COOK chicken in large nonstick skillet on medium-high heat for 5 to 7
    minutes or until cooked through, stirring occasionally.
    STIR in 2 cups water. Bring to boil. Stir in macaroni; cover. Reduce
    heat to medium. Simmer 15 minutes or until water is almost absorbed.
    ADD VELVEETA and tomatoes. Cook until VELVEETA is melted, stirring
    frequently. Remove from heat; stir in sour cream. Sprinkle with parsley.

    The Three Wiseman:

    *1/2oz Johnnie Walker Scotch
    *1/2oz Jack Daniel’s Whiskey
    *1/2oz Jim Bean Bourbon

    1-Pour all 3 whiskeys into a shaker full of ice
    2-Shake VERY well
    3-Strain into shot glass
    4-Throw it back & enjoy!

    The 4 Horseman:
    *1/2oz Johnnie Walker Scotch
    *1/2oz Jack Daniel’s Whiskey
    *1/2oz Jim Bean Bourbon
    *1/2oz Jose Cuervo

    1-Pour all 4 shots into a shaker full of ice
    2-Shake VERY well
    3-Strain into shot glass
    4-Throw it back & enjoy!
